Partnership Contracts Templates

Partnership contracts templates are essential documents that lay out the legal framework of a partnership between two or more entities. Whether it`s a small business venture or a larger-scale collaboration, a partnership agreement helps ensure that all parties involved are on the same page and have clear expectations of their rights and responsibilities.

When it comes to drafting a partnership contract, it`s important to cover all the necessary bases. This includes details on the roles and responsibilities of each partner, the division of profits and losses, decision-making processes, termination clauses, and dispute resolution methods.

While every partnership will have unique needs, there are several key sections that should be included in any contract template:

1. Partnership purpose and scope: This clarifies the goals of the partnership and outlines the specific activities the partners will engage in.

2. Partner contributions: This outlines how much each partner will invest in the partnership in terms of finances, resources, or time.

3. Management and decision-making: This section covers the systems for decision-making and how management responsibilities will be allocated among the partners.

4. Profit and loss distribution: This outlines how profits and losses will be shared among the partners based on their contributions to the partnership.

5. Termination and dissolution: This section covers how the partnership can be dissolved and the steps each partner can take if they choose to leave.

When it comes to customizing a partnership contract, it`s important to seek legal advice to ensure that the agreement is binding and enforceable.
